The train journey from Leipzig to Bad Salzungen offers scenic views, especially as it passes through the picturesque Thuringian Forest, featuring lush landscapes, rolling hills, and charming small towns.
To fully enjoy Bad Salzungen and its attractions, including the historic town center, Gradierwerk saltworks, and local spa amenities, a stay of 2 to 3 days is recommended.

Yes, rail passes such as the Eurail Pass and Interrail Pass are valid on most trains in Germany, including Deutsche Bahn regional and long-distance services. Some high-speed trains may require a reservation fee even with a rail pass.
Germany uses the euro (€) as its currency. Travelers generally find it convenient to use cards, especially contactless payments, in cities and larger establishments. However, cash is still widely accepted and sometimes preferred in smaller shops, markets, and rural areas. Carrying some cash is recommended for flexibility.
